We received our first snow fall of the year today!! And I wasn't about to let a little snow get in the way of a little adventure I had planned. A couple of my girlfriends and I had arranged a 22km run from Grouse Mountain to Deep Cove.

We had special guest join us at the last minute - The Lazy Trail Runner - himself Mr. C. He wrote a funny post on his blog about the run - check it out here - but I still wanted to share some of my favorite pics from the day.
